iPod Battery Broken; Will Replacing the Battery Fix it?
Recently I opened up my iPod to replace its cracked screen. While I was attempting to remove the battery, I accidentally punctured it and it began to smoke. I'm not sure if it was just me panicking, but I think I heard a crackle. I also closed the iPod right away (which was a bad idea in hindsight), so it got really hot. If I replace the battery, will it fix the iPod, or is the iPod shorted out?

Clayton, I think the only thing you shortened out was the battery. May be the crackle you heard was the lithium in the battery reacting with the humidity in the air. Replace the battery and see what happens. I have ruined a LCD with the heat from a bad battery before but hopefully this will work for you.
